Compare Cleveland Heights to Marion

This post compares Cleveland Heights, Ohio to Marion, Ohio across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Cleveland Heights (city) Marion (city)
Population 45,024 36,399
Income (median) $51,550 $36,212
Home Value (median) $129,300 $72,200
White 49% 85%
Black 41% 8%
Asian 5% 0%
With Kids 25% 29%
Age (median) 36 37
Rentals 44% 43%
